Your New Neighbors Might Have Antlers

One of the coolest things about living in Castle Pines Village is the wildlife. Deer and elk are regular visitors, foxes and bobcats occasionally wander through, and yes — even bears and moose have been spotted. It’s like living in a nature documentary… only you still get DoorDash.

Schools + Community

Families love Castle Pines for more than the scenery. Douglas County schools have a great reputation, and The Village offers resort-style amenities: multiple pools, tennis and pickleball courts, fitness centers, and two Jack Nicklaus–designed golf courses. Oh, and 24/7 security for extra peace of mind.
